Group SEVENTEEN members WONWOO and MINGYU released a special video for their new song “Bittersweet.”

Pledis Entertainment agency released a special video for WONWOO and MINGYU’s digital single, “Bittersweet (Feat. Lee Hi)” on SEVENTEEN’s YouTube channel and official SNS on the afternoon of May 29th, sparking reactions. enthusiastic fans around the world.
The posted video began with the fascinating introduction of WONWOO following the magnificent guitar riff, captivating ears in the blink of an eye and making them immerse into the video. In addition, MINGYU’s delicate expression attracted music lovers by maximizing the atmosphere.
In particular, WONWOO and MINGYU of the SEVENTEEN hip-hop team showed not only their broad musical spectrum, but also their vocal abilities and unexpected charm, proving the “complete combination”, their warm visuals and deep gazes made the viewers unable to look away.
The digital single “Bittersweet (Feat. Lee Hi)” in which you can feel the color of manly voice and mature mood of WONWOO and MINGYU is a song that expresses the sweetness of love and the bitterness of the friendship that WONWOO and MINGYU have found.
In addition, “Bittersweet” had a fantastic synergy with the uniquely sounding artist Lee Hi, featured participant, and the music video released with the song attracts attention thanks to director Kim Jong Kwan of the movie “Josée “.
After its release, “Bittersweet” ranked first in 10 regions, including Indonesia, the Philippines, Vietnam and Peru, and ranked in the top 10 in 25 regions, giving WONWOO and MINGYU the feeling of their global status.
Meanwhile, SEVENTEEN, which includes WONWOO and MINGYU, will release their eighth mini album “YOUR CHOICE” at 6pm on June 18th.
